One-stage Versus Two-stage Revision of the Infected Knee Arthroplasty

This study investigates functional outcome and safety after one-stage versus two-stage revision of the infected knee arthroplasty.

Half of participants are treated with a one-stage surgical procedure, while the other half is treated with a two-stage procedure.

The investigators hypothesize that the functional outcome and quality of life of the participants is superior after one-stage surgery compared to two-stage surgery.

About this study

A two-stage approach is the standard surgical procedure in the treatment of the chronically infected knee arthroplasty, but promising results have been reported after a one-stage approach from single-centre studies.

The potential benefits for the patients treated with a one-stage approach are many as they only have to go through surgery and rehabilitation once with shorter total length of hospital stay. However, no randomized controlled trials comparing outcome after the procedures have been performed so far.

Inclusion criteria

  • Clinical signs of periprosthetic knee infection
  • > 6 weeks from previous knee arthoplasty procedure (primary or total revision procedure)
  • Speak and understand Danish and have given informed consent

Exclusion criteria

  • Soft tissue problems requiring plastic surgery
  • major bone loss requiring mega/tumor-prosthesis
  • acute surgery due to sepsis
  • malignant disease with less than 2 years life expectancy
  • re-infection with previous two-stage procedure
  • bilateral knee infection

Primary outcomes

  1. Oxford Knee Score (AUC)

    Time frame: preoperatively 6 weeks, 3, 6, 9, 12 months postoperatively.

    Area Under Curve for Oxford Knee Score

Secondary outcomes

  1. Oxford Knee Score (AUC)

    Time frame: preoperatively, 6 weeks, 3, 6, 9, 12, 18 and 24 months postoperatively.

    Area Under Curve for Oxford Knee Score

  2. EQ-5D-5L

    Time frame: preoperatively, 6 weeks, 3, 6, 9, 12, 18 and 24 months postoperatively.

    Quality of life questionnaire

  3. Re-revision rate

    Time frame: 2 year postoperatively

    re-revisions due to infection and other causes

  4. mortality

    Time frame: 90 days postoperatively and 1 and 2 year postoperatively

    postoperative mortality

  5. readmission rate

    Time frame: 90 days postoperatively

    postoperative readmission rate

  6. Range of Motion

    Time frame: 2 years postoperatively

    Range of motion of the infected/operated knee
